在Mooddle中上传和重命名文件插件

时间:2017-01-15 14:19:05

标签: php file plugins upload moodle

我对Mooddle开发很新,我不确定如何实现这个目标,但如果有人能帮助我,我会非常感激。

我要做的是“克隆”文件上传插件并创建一个完全相同但又重命名文件的新插件。这样做的目的是教师需要上传课程路线图,但有些人不这样做;所以管理所有课程的人需要能够在数据库中检查教师上传的内容以及教师没有上传的内容。

这个想法是有一个名为“课程路线图”的专用按钮,让老师通过这个按钮上传,因为不是所有教师都将文件命名为相同,我想将文件重命名为,例如,“roadmap_design”,“roadmap_law”,“roadmap_architecture”等,是位于每个文件开头的“roadmap_”一词。

我正在使用Moodle 3.0和Essential Theme。我不知道在哪里可以找到插件源代码来复制它并为新插件编辑它。我该如何安装这个新插件?

希望这是可能的,有人可以帮助我。谢谢!

1 个答案:

答案 0 :(得分:0)

插件处理的所有文件相关内容由“存储库”完成 https://docs.moodle.org/dev/Repository_plugins应该让你入门。您可以克隆/存储库/上传,但请注意,您必须在上面的文档中更新多个文件和类名(请参阅创建新的存储库插件)。

运行克隆后,您可以在此处调整上传例程以进行重命名

不幸的是我无法附加文件,请罚款附加我的“克隆”upload2目录。您可以在wetransfer

下载

enter image description here